The Baptist Union of Papua New Guinea is a Baptist Christian denomination in Papua New Guinea. It is affiliated with the Baptist World Alliance. The headquarters is in Mount Hagen.

Contents

History

The Baptist Union of Papua New Guinea has its origins in a mission of the Australian Baptist Ministries in 1850. [1] It is officially founded in 1977. [2] According to a census published by the association in 2023, it claimed 493 churches and 84,700 members. [3]

Schools

The convention has 40 primary schools gathered in the Baptist Education Agency. [4]

It has 2 affiliated theological institutes. [5]

Health Services

The convention has 3 hospitals. [6]
